Game Overview
Bounty County is a Relax Gaming video pokie built around a 6-column, 6-row scatter-pay setup. Instead of paylines, the game pays when at least four matching paying symbols appear anywhere on the reels. Winning symbols then vanish and new symbols drop in, so one spin can keep working through several cascades. The real twist sits around the inner grid, where crates and bandits can be hit or destroyed by adjacent wins. Destroying all Bandits during a base game spin awards either the Bonus or Super Bonus feature. The game has medium volatility, a main RTP of 96.10%, and a maximum win capped at 5,000x total bet. Stakes run from $0.10 to $200 per spin, with Double Bet and Buy Feature options adding more control over the bonus route.

Paytable & Symbol Values
Bounty County uses scatter pays, so regular symbols pay when four or more of the same kind appear anywhere on the reels. The top-paying regular symbols are the red-hat cowboy, purple-hat cowgirl and blue-hat sheriff, each paying up to 50x the bet for 9 or more symbols. The clover, whisky bottle and horseshoe sit below them, each reaching up to 20x for 9 or more. The lower symbols are the wooden card royals A, K, Q and J. These pay from four matching symbols and climb to 10x for 9 or more. The values are not huge on their own, but scatter pays and cascades make them important because even smaller hits can remove symbols and strike nearby special targets.

Bounty County on Mobile Devices and Other Platforms
Bounty County plays well on mobile, but the layout asks for more attention than a plain 5-reel pokie. The 4x4 inner area handles cascades, while the surrounding special-symbol area controls crates, TNT and Bandit hits. Portrait mode works for quick spins, but landscape is better when you want to follow every reaction. Tablet and desktop give the bonus more space, especially when Boss Bandits, counters and multiplier changes appear together. We would use phones for short sessions and larger screens for reading the feature properly.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do wins work in Bounty County?
Bounty County uses scatter pays. You need at least four matching paying symbols anywhere on the reels, rather than matching symbols across fixed paylines.
Does Bounty County have Bonus Buy?
Yes. Buy Bonus costs 50x the normal bet, while Buy Super Bonus costs 100x. The option may not appear in every casino or market.
What does Double Bet do?
Double Bet plays at 2x the normal stake. It increases average hit rate and makes bonus entry more frequent, with stronger access to Super Bonus rounds.
What is the RTP of Bounty County?
Bounty County has a main RTP of 96.10%, with lower alternative versions possible in some markets. Check the in-game help screen before real-money play.
What is the maximum win in Bounty County?
The maximum win is capped at 5,000x total bet. When the round reaches that amount or higher, the game ends and awards the capped prize.
